#WOTR19 #NewRelease #Review Lobos: Big Bend Wolves by Victoria Danann and Teresa Gabelman

The Three Rivers Pack has been deeply embedded in Kerrville commerce and society for generations. They own businesses and hold government offices, including that of sheriff. But the influx of retirees and well-to-do building second homes in the Hill Country has squeezed the shifters for room to run.

The only answer is relocation to a less populated locale and that will require making a deal with the pack that holds that territory. The alliance struck by the two alphas is blood seal, a political mating between the Lobos alpha’s daughter and the Three Rivers alpha’s son. It’s the perfect solution that benefits both tribes.

Except nobody asked Fleet Ryder and Dani Alvarez if they were willing. And they aren’t.

Teresa Gabelman comes together with Victoria Danann to bring us a new shifter story.

The Alpha of the Three Rivers pack realizes that it is time for his pack to move on, humans have moved in droves to their once little town and it’s just not safe anymore.

The Lobos pack has plenty of room, more than enough room for two packs, what they lack however is the funds to keep their pack going.  The two Alphas come to an agreement, Three Rivers will move and pay into the Lobos pack and both Alphas pledge that their children will marry the other.  

 Arranged marriages in this day and age is outrageous and Fleet, son of the Alpha from Three Rivers and Danita, the daughter of the Alpha from Lobos, are not happy that they have been thrown at the other for the sake of their packs.

Ok, this story maybe on the shorter side but Fleet and Danika’s story is awesome long or short.

The way these two know that no matter what they have to do what’s right for the packs and decide to see if they will make a good mated pair is really sweet and their friends!! Their besties all help them spend some time away from the packs and together before the mating.  

So, not only do we get one of the sweetest love stories, but let’s face it it’s shifters so it’s also HOT, we also get a little danger in the story too!!  Not everyone is so happy about this mating, even if the pair themselves were against it in the beginning.

I certainly hope we get to see more from these two lovely authors, they go together so well.

Teresa Gabelman is the New York Times and USA Today bestselling author of the ‘Protectors Series’. When not writing about sexy alpha vampires and the women who drive them crazy she can be found on a lake with a fishing pole/Kindle, at a MMA event or spending a fun evening with family.

Being a full-time writer has allowed Teresa to connect more with readers which is what she loves most about writing. If you find the time she would love to hear from you!

New York Times and USA Today Bestselling Author, Victoria Danann, is the author of over twenty five romances: paranormal, scifi, and contemporary.

Her Knights of Black Swan series won BEST PARANORMAL ROMANCE SERIES FOUR YEARS IN A ROW. – Reviewers Choice Awards, The Paranormal Romance Guild.

She also won Paranormal Romance Novel of the Year FOUR YEARS IN A ROW and Scifi Fantasy Series and Novel of the year this past year..
